I'm the independent producer of The Sound of Young America, a radio show and podcast based in San Francisco. The show is broadcast on KUSP in Santa Cruz; KSFS, San Francisco; KWCW, in Washington; WMCO in New Concord, Ohio and WUSM, Hattiesburg. It's also podcast to thousands on the internet, making it one of the more popular public radio podcasts.
Besides producing the show, I work as a sketch comedian and at the conservation non-profit The Trust for Public Land. I was news director of KZSC for two years, and have also worked at XM Satellite Radio and West Coast Live.
Salon.com wrote about The Sound of Young America that, "If you've never heard of The Sound of Young America, The Sound of Young America is the greatest radio show you've never heard of."
It was also recently chosen "Pick of the Podcasts" by Time Magazine.
